| This chapter introduces the performance characteristics of IoTDB from the perspectives of database connection, database read and write performance, and storage performance. |
| |
| ## Database connection |
| |
| - In the 16C32GB machine, the number of concurrent connections of the IoTDB server can exceed 20,000 times per second. |
| |
| |
| ## Read and write performance |
| |
| - When the client uses an 8C machine and sets concurrency to 8, the maximum writing throughput of IoTDB on a single-core server can exceed 49,000 times per second. |
| - When the client uses a 16C32GB machine and sets concurrency to 10, the writing throughput of IoTDB deployed on 16C32GB server can reach 33.22 million points/second. |
| - When the client uses a 16C32GB machine and sets concurrency to 10, the reading throughput of IoTDB deployed on 16C32GB server can reach 67.91 million points/second. |
| - When the client uses three 64C256GB machines and sets concurrency to 192, the writing throughput of IoTDB deployed on three 64C256GB servers(1ConfigNode + 3DataNode) can reach 523 million points/second. |
| - IoTDB can support aggregation queries of tens of billions of data, and when deployed on a single 16C32GB server, IoTDB can return the calculation results of tens of billions of data in milliseconds. |
| |
| ## Storage performance |
| |
| - IoTDB supports the storage and processing of PB-level data. |
| - Using the ZSTD compression method, IoTDB can achieve a compression rate of 10% for the raw data of the numerical type. |
